GREAT Jubilee Family Festival

The GREAT Jubilee Family Festival is an inexpensive & fun way to entertain your whole family and a have a fun afternoon in the beautiful grounds of Oglethorpe University.Β 


An international ambience with music & dance representing the Commonwealth countries, including Africa, India, The Caribbean, England, Scotland, Wales & much more.


In addition, we will be celbrating the 60th Anniversary of the Coronation of Queen Elizabeth II, which took place June 2, 1953.
